Lack of Health
Care
Children's Health
-
malaria, preventable
and curable, is the leading killer of children under five years of age
-
34% of children under five
are malnourished
-
infant mortality rate is near 10%
Challenges in Education
-
approximately one-third
of the population aged 16 and over is illiterate.
-
almost one-half of the population is 15 years of age or under
-
4 out of 10 children are not in school due to poverty, sickness, or
displacement.

Agriculture
-
97% of the population is
sustainance farmers
-
winter is a dry season where no crops are grown
-
fertilizer is generally too expensive to use
-
modern agricultural practices are not used; no tractors, no modern
machinery etc.

Poverty and Economic Opportunities
-
80% of the population lives on less than 50 cents a day
-
banks do not exist
outside of the large cities
